Stephen Conrad

Chief Executive Officer

Stephen joined LLS in 2020 after most recently serving as advisor, Board Member and CFO of Litigation Capital Management Limited. Prior to this, Stephen had a 25 year career in financial markets specialising in risk management, capital and strategy working for global investment banks in Australia, Hong Kong and Singapore. Stephen holds a Master of Applied Finance from Macquarie University together with a post graduate in Applied Finance and Investments from the Securities Institute of Australia, a B.Ec from the University of Newcastle and is a Graduate of the Australian Institute of Company Directors.


Emma Colantonio

Senior Investment Manager

Emma holds both Bachelor of Laws and Bachelor of Business degrees from Western Sydney University. Emma was admitted to the legal profession in 2010 and has extensive experience from roles in both private practice, most recently as Senior Associate with MinterEllison, and in-house as senior legal counsel for one of Australia’s major banks. Commencing with Litigation Lending in 2021, Emma has specialist knowledge and experience in large complex litigation including in the areas of financial services disputes, regulatory investigations, consumer and commercial disputes and insolvency


Laura Morrissey

Investment Manager

Laura holds a Bachelor of Laws from the University of Southern Queensland. Laura was admitted to the legal profession in 2015 and has extensive experience from roles in private practice, most recently as a Senior Associate with HWL Ebsworth Lawyers. Commencing with Litigation Lending in 2021, Laura has specialist knowledge and experience in commercial litigation and insolvency matters. Laura has particular experience acting for insolvency practitioners in large complex litigation, individuals and companies in contentious matters, as well as contractual, competition and consumer, and defamation disputes.

Mark Arbib

Director of Strategy and Stakeholder Engagement

Mark is a former Federal Government Minister and Australian Senator, serving 2008 to 2012. He brings valuable experience to LLS across politics, community and business. During his political career, Mark held numerous portfolios including; Minister for Employment Participation, Indigenous Employment, Social Housing, Homelessness, Sport and Assistant Treasurer. In Business, Mark served as Director of Strategy and Business Development at Consolidated Press Holdings, 2012-2022. Mark is a board member of the Australian Olympic Committee, the Packer Family Foundation and was the former President of Athletics Australia. He was commissioned and undertook a governance review of Australian Rugby Union (ARU) in 2013. Mark is a former board member of Sydney FC and South Sydney Rugby League Football Club.
